Thoughts and Meditations on Homosexuality

In homosexual love the passion is homosexuality itself. What a homosexual loves, as if it were his lover, his country, his art, his land, is homosexuality. - Marguerite Duras

In itself, homosexuality is as limiting as heterosexuality: the ideal should be to be capable of loving a woman or a man; either, a human being, without feeling fear, restraint, or obligation. - Simone de Beauvoir

Homosexuality is God's way of insuring that the truly gifted aren't burdened with children. - Samuel Austin Allibone

It always seemed to me a bit pointless to disapprove of homosexuality. It's like disapproving of rain. - Francis Maude

The love that dare not speak its name has become the love that won't shut up. - Robertson Davies

I don't think homosexuality is a choice. Society forces you to think it's a choice, but in fact, it's in one's nature. The choice is whether one expresses one's nature truthfully or spends the rest of one's life lying about it. - Marlo Thomas

Homosexuality is like the weather. It just is. - Andrew Sullivan

Homosexuality was invented by a straight world dealing with its own bisexuality. - Kate Millett
